Why use a CD-R verifier?
A CD-R verifier checks whether the data written to a CD-R is readable and uncorrupted. Verification helps you:
- Prevent silent data loss from marginal burns.
- Confirm audio/ripping projects were written correctly.
- Validate discs before long-term archiving or distribution.
- Identify hardware issues (drive or media quality) early.
Verification is not the same as a surface scan. Verification focuses on reading back the burned session or files and comparing checksums or file contents; surface scans (and scans of C1/C2 errors) analyze physical error rates on the disc.
What to look for in 2025
- Compatibility with modern operating systems (Windows ⁄11, macOS 12–14, and Linux distributions).
- Support for multi-session discs and various filesystem formats (ISO9660, Joliet, UDF, HFS+).
- Ability to verify by file comparison, checksum (MD5/SHA), or 1:1 image verification (BIN/ISO).
- Advanced diagnostics: S.M.A.R.T.-style error reporting, read retries, and optical drive error counters (C1/C2/PI/PO).
- Batch verification and logging for large archival projects.
- Support for drive-specific features (some modern drives expose advanced error metrics).
Top free CD-R verifier tools
1) ExactAudioCopy (EAC) — best for audio-focused verification
- Platform: Windows
- What it does: Primarily an audio ripping and verification tool; can perform burst and secure reads and verify audio tracks by comparing checksums and doing AccurateRip checks.
- Strengths: Excellent for audio CDs, strong community database (AccurateRip), detailed error reporting.
- Limitations: Focused on audio; not designed for generic data CD verification.
2) InfraRecorder (with tools) — simple data verification
- Platform: Windows
- What it does: Free burning software with a verify-after-write option that reads written files and compares them to source files.
- Strengths: Lightweight, easy to use, suitable for casual users verifying small batches.
- Limitations: Limited diagnostics and logging; not ideal for archival-grade verification.
3) ddrescue / dd (and cmp) — powerful command-line verification (Linux/macOS)
- Platform: Linux, macOS (via Homebrew), Windows via WSL
- What it does: Create raw disc images with dd or ddrescue, then compare images or checksums with cmp, md5sum, or sha256sum.
- Strengths: Full control, reproducible 1:1 image verification, excellent for automation and scripting.
- Limitations: Command-line only; requires technical knowledge; won’t report drive-specific error counters by default.
4) CDRoller (free demo features) — read-recovery tools
- Platform: Windows
- What it does: Specialized in recovering data from problematic discs and can verify readable file sets.
- Strengths: Robust recovery tools, helpful for discs with read errors.
- Limitations: Full functionality is paid; demo may be limited.
Top paid CD-R verifier tools
1) Nero Burning ROM — full-featured suite with verification
- Platform: Windows
- Price: Commercial (one-time or subscription options via Nero suites)
- What it does: Industry-standard burning software with verify-after-write, disc spanning, multisession support, and detailed logs.
- Strengths: Polished UI, broad feature set, good for professional workflows.
- Limitations: Heavier software; license cost.
2) Plextools Professional — advanced drive diagnostics and scanning
- Platform: Windows
- Price: Paid (often bundled with Plextor drives or sold separately)
- What it does: Detailed optical drive diagnostics, C1/C2 and PI/PO scanning, secure erase, and verification features.
- Strengths: Best-in-class physical error reporting when used with compatible Plextor drives; ideal for archival-quality verification.
- Limitations: Works best with Plextor drives; higher cost.
3) IsoBuster (Pro) — file-level verification and recovery
- Platform: Windows
- Price: Paid (Pro license)
- What it does: Reads and extracts files from optical media and performs comparisons; recovers data from malformed sessions.
- Strengths: Excellent for complex discs (mixed mode, multisession, UDF), strong recovery and verification tools.
- Limitations: Paid for Pro features; Windows-only.
4) Verbatim DatalifePlus / proprietary tools with media vendors
- Platform: Varies
- What it does: Some media vendors provide bundled verification or diagnostic tools optimized for their media.
- Strengths: Tailored to specific media; sometimes included free with premium discs.
- Limitations: Vendor-locked features and limited general applicability.
How to verify CDs — recommended workflows
-
Quick verify (casual use)
- Use a burning app with “Verify after burn” enabled (Nero, InfraRecorder).
- Good for single discs or small batches.
-
File/hash verification (recommended for archival)
- Create checksums of source files (e.g., SHA-256).
- Burn disc.
- Read files back and recompute checksums or create an ISO image and compare hashes.
- Tools: dd + sha256sum, IsoBuster Pro, cmp.
-
1:1 image verification (best for exact-copy needs)
- Create an image of the burned CD (ISO/BIN).
- Compare that image to the original image bit-by-bit.
- Tools: ddrescue, cmp, Nero’s image verification.
-
Audio verification (music-focused)
- Rip and compare audio tracks using AccurateRip or EAC.
- Verify TOC and track lengths.
- Tools: ExactAudioCopy, CUETools (for checksum-based verification of audio files/FLAC).
-
Physical error scanning (archival/quality control)
- Use Plextools Professional or drives that expose C1/C2 and PI/PO metrics to run scans.
- Target acceptable thresholds depending on archival standards (lower PI/PO values = better).
Compatibility and drive considerations
- Not all optical drives expose low-level error counters. For physical error analysis you often need:
- A drive known to report C1/C2 or PI/PO (Plextor historically does this reliably).
- Software that knows how to query that drive (Plextools, some drive-specific utilities).
- Modern laptops increasingly lack built-in optical drives; verify using external USB optical drives. Some USB bridge chips hide low-level drive features, limiting advanced diagnostics.
- Use high-quality media (Verbatim, Taiyo Yuden if still available) and burn at conservative speeds for archival reliability.

Practical tips and troubleshooting
- If verify fails:
- Try reburning at a lower speed.
- Use a different brand/batch of media.
- Clean the drive laser and try a different drive.
- Read back on multiple drives to rule out drive-specific read errors.
- Always keep original source checksums stored separately (e.g., checksum file on cloud or another offline medium).
- For long-term archiving, duplicate critical discs and store them in different physical locations.
Which tool should you pick?
- For music enthusiasts: ExactAudioCopy (free) for accurate audio verification.
- For simple data backups: Use a burning app with verify-after-write (InfraRecorder or Nero).
- For archival, forensic, or professional use: Plextools Professional (for physical metrics) + image/hash workflows (ddrescue + sha256) or IsoBuster Pro for complex disc types.
- For automation and scripting: command-line dd/ddrescue + checksums.
Verification adds minutes to the burning process but yields far greater confidence in the integrity of your discs. Pick a tool that fits your media type (audio vs data), your need for physical diagnostics, and your platform, and automate checksums where possible for consistent, auditable archival workflows.
